Transaction 087d923d4e6e10868c6c0dce27f7dca136b33662e61f0fc90b48d9da1949c59e

block
b11cc85c4f6a201ffd3b6294ba479a840c582f72b9dd69720dadf5e63bcbbc0d

17 Inputs

2 Outputs